Program Analysis

Graduates of the Research and Experimental Psychology program at the University of Rochester earn more than the national average for this major. One year after graduation, University of Rochester alumni earn $39,732, which is higher than the national average of $37,767. Five years after graduation, alumni earn $68,347.

The program has a debt-to-earnings ratio of zero. The provided data indicates that graduates have no debt.

Sixty-six students graduate from this program each year.
